Property Details for 19 Morgan Pl, Mckail

19 Morgan Pl, Mckail is a 5 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 4 parking spaces and was built in 1980. The property has a land size of 4045m2 and floor size of 156m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in April 2025. Last Listing description (April 2025)

Stuck in a 1980s time warp it may be but this fabulous lifestyle property no doubt considered "rad" in its day, could easily be fast tracked to the future to look pretty "epic" with a contemporary facelift.It offers a pleasant setting handy to parks and amenities.Exploring the classic solid double brick, solar passive family home reveals huge living spaces and plenty more, while the traditional almost one acre of land it is set well-back on has its own stand-outs. Starting with the home, you will find tell-tale 1980s styling from the archways and exposed brick to solid timber mouldings and ornate plasterwork.However, the big selling features here are the huge living zones and incredible amount of built-in household and bedroom storage.The entry flows right to a spacious dining room, separate big kitchen and a classic semi-open lounge.This adjoins a huge enclosed patio-cum-sunroom ideal for year-round entertaining, Sunday barbies and a kids' winter play area.More surprises lay left down a hall off the entry, where there is a massive games room ideal for a billiard table, bar and stacks more.This hall also contains a study, incredible banks of storage, five bedrooms with excellent robe space, and a toilet, powder room, spacious laundry, basic bathroom and patio access.Outside there is great lot access for a truck, caravan or boat, and a rear four-bay carport, two-bay garage and linked workshop, extra sheds and a shadehouse, chook pen and untapped land.Capitalise on this special lifestyle opportunity.For more detailed information or to arrange a private viewing please contact Kathleen Mier on 0439 421 059.

About Mckail 6330

The size of Mckail is approximately 9.9 square kilometres. It has 3 parks covering nearly 3.0% of total area. The population of Mckail in 2016 was 3445 people. By 2021 the population was 3970 showing a population growth of 15.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Mckail is 0-9 years. Households in Mckail are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Mckail work in a community and personal service occupation.In 2021, 72.80% of the homes in Mckail were owner-occupied compared with 71.50% in 2016.

Mckail has 1,923 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Mckail have seen a 104.54% increase in median value.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Mckail is $744,561 while the median value for Units is $533,060.
  • Houses have a median rent of $630.
